PJM, Penn State and ISO-NE Awarded DOE Grant To Improve Market Design

Retrieved on: 
Martedì, Aprile 30, 2024

VALLEY FORGE, Pa., April 30, 2024 /PRNewswire/ -- A collaborative project among PJM Interconnection, Penn State and ISO New England has won funding from a U.S. Department of Energy program designed to develop and improve wholesale electricity markets.

Key Points: 
  • Penn State was awarded up to $815,959 in a three-year grant to identify market design changes to efficiently integrate batteries and other nontraditional resources that operate with changing real-time constraints on a grid that is experiencing more uncertainty in electricity demand, or load.
  • The project will use a realistic market simulation model with PJM and ISO-NE to achieve the best performance across the objectives of reliability, efficiency and investment incentives.

NPCC’s Winter Reliability Assessment Indicates Adequate Electricity Supplies Under Forecasted Conditions

Retrieved on: 
Martedì, Dicembre 12, 2023

Northeast Power Coordinating Council’s (NPCC’s) annual winter reliability assessment forecasts its region will have an adequate supply of electricity this winter to meet projected peak demand under a variety of forecasted weather conditions.

Key Points: 
  • Northeast Power Coordinating Council’s (NPCC’s) annual winter reliability assessment forecasts its region will have an adequate supply of electricity this winter to meet projected peak demand under a variety of forecasted weather conditions.
  • An installed winter capacity of 169,291 MW is projected to be in place to meet the forecasted electricity demand, which is 1,257 MW less than last winter.

Convergent Energy and Power Partners with West Boylston Municipal Light Plant to Provide Cost-Reducing Battery Storage System

Retrieved on: 
Mercoledì, Settembre 27, 2023

Convergent Energy and Power (Convergent), a leading provider of energy storage solutions in North America, announced today its plans to provide Massachusetts’s municipally-owned utility company West Boylston Municipal Light Plant (WBMLP) with a battery storage system; the system is expected to stabilize costs for its customers and further insulate against rising energy costs.

Key Points: 
  • Convergent Energy and Power (Convergent), a leading provider of energy storage solutions in North America, announced today its plans to provide Massachusetts’s municipally-owned utility company West Boylston Municipal Light Plant (WBMLP) with a battery storage system; the system is expected to stabilize costs for its customers and further insulate against rising energy costs.
  • Convergent will finance, own, and operate the 3MW/9MWh utility-scale battery storage system for WBMLP, leveraging its proprietary energy storage intelligence, PEAK IQ®.
